1 Arrested Over Wa Abduction, Murder

The police in the Upper West region have arrested one person in connection with the murder of Seidu Baga, a private security man who went missing last week.

The suspect, Kankani Adongo, was arrested on Monday at Bamahu, a suburb of Wa.

He was reportedly arrested through the combined effort of the police and the community search party.

The suspect is in custody and will be arraigned before a court to face justice, the police said in a statement.

Seidu Baga, a private security man in the community was reported missing on Friday, September 16, 2022.

His corpse was later found in a shallow grave on Sunday.

This is not the first time a person has gone missing and has been later found dead in the Wa municipality.

The Municipal Chief Executive for Wa, Tahiru Issahaku Moomin says seven private security men have been abducted and murdered in the Assembly within the space of one year.

No arrest has been effected with regard to the previous cases.
